Jiiva reunites with ‘Black' director for his next; film goes on floors

KR Group, the banner bankrolling the project, unveiled pictures from the event to announce the news. The event was attended by actor Vishal, producer RB Choudhary, and distributor Tirupu Subramaniam.

Tentatively called Jiiva 46, the film features actor Rabia Khatoon as the female lead. Actors Nyla Usha and Aadukalam Naren are set to play pivotal roles. Actor Babloo Prithviraj, who has been in the limelight for his performance in Sandeep Reddy Vanga's Animal, is also part of the cast.
The film has cinematography by Gokul Benoy and editing by RS Satheesh Kumar. Kannan Ravi produces the film under the KR Group production banner.
